Output 85d579ea48d9a514b30d4ade0d1cb1943bdcb5aaf4f2bcbd0c4986eea414a2be:2

value
679605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5a63effd75bdccdb6a4309bbaccc925aa6d3ae8 OP_EQUAL
address
3Ki6CKEqSWw4Rm625i8LU1DU5TCu7uBRsJ
transaction
85d579ea48d9a514b30d4ade0d1cb1943bdcb5aaf4f2bcbd0c4986eea414a2be
confirmations
373621
spent
true